STEERING / SUSPENSION

STEERING WHEEL REMOVAL (NON-EPS)

CAUTION
This procedure should NOT be used on EPS models.
Using this procedure on an EPS model can
permanently damage the EPS unit and cause a Power
Steering Fault.
1. Remove the steering wheel cap.
2. Loosen the nut and back it half way off the steering
shaft.
3. With a glove on your hand, place it under the
steering wheel. Lift upward on the inner portion of the
steering wheel while using a hammer to strike the
steering shaft nut.
NOTICE
If the steering wheel will not pop loose, proceed to
Steering Shaft Removal (Non-EPS)page 8.6.
4. Once the steering wheel pops loose, completely
remove the nut and lift the steering wheel off the
shaft.

STEERING SHAFT REMOVAL (NON-EPS)

1. Remove the pinch bolt retaining the lower portion of
the steering shaft to the steering gear box assembly.
2. Remove upper and lower dash panels. Refer to
"Dash Panel / Glove Box Removal"page 10.30
procedure.
3. Remove the steering wheel tilt assembly fasteners
(B) and remove the tilt shock.
4. Remove the steering shaft, pivot tube and steering
wheel from the vehicle as an assembly.
5. Refer to steps 11-13 of the "Steering Shaft Bearing
Replacement"page 8.8 procedure for installation.
